From BuildZoom: Imperial Homes Inc, 5251 Benton St, Cape Coral, FL (Owned by: Jwells Inc) holds a Construction Business Information license and 4 other licenses according to the Florida license board.

Their BuildZoom score of 57 does not rank in the top 50% of Florida contractors.

Their license was verified as active when we last checked. If you are thinking of hiring Imperial Homes Inc, we recommend double-checking their license status with the license board and using our project planner to get competitive quotes.

    Our home began January, 2018. It has been a painful process and to this date (March, 2020), it is still not completely done. We moved in at the end of July, because the city inspector felts sorry for us because we had no where to go. We had now moved 3 times in two years. Things that were suppose to be done where not during the build phase, moving house on lot cost of thousands of dollars that builder did not know and we are doing alot of the final work ourselves since builder has not sent anyone back since July to finish. Stay away from this builder - run as fast as you can. They are not honest folks and communication skills suck!

    We order a new home in Oct 2016 to finished and ready to move into by Dec. 1-2017. Imperial Homes did not follow that contract so our house was not built the way we wanted it. After we signed a contract they said that our house had more sq. ft. than what they told us and wanted more many. We were out of state buyers and communications with Mike and Justin was terrible. I had to make several trims back to Florida to inspect the construction finding many issues that were wrong. Somethings were fixable some not and was told we had to live with it. By Dec. of 2018 our house not completely done and we had to fire Imperial Homes and seek another avenue to finish our house. Mike and Justin was terrible to work with never kept their promises. They talk the talk but don't have skills New home buyers beware you have been warned,

    Building 2 cash homes with Imperial Homes. First one took 2 years 4 months and the second is abandoned after 1 year 8 months and both incomplete. Was told today by owners, they let all employees go and have no funds to completed the scheduled homes. We would have to pay the vendors direct and they would assist. May be an easy way to start over without filing for bankruptcy. Not sure.
